Dive into the compelling world of financial accountability with Jacob Soll’s ‘The Reckoning: Financial Accountability and the Rise and Fall of Nations’. This hardcover edition is a provocative exploration through the tapestry of economic and political history, questioning the drivers behind the success and failure of nations. Published by Basic Books in 2014, the volume is an essential read for anyone interested in the intersection of finance, history, and politics.
